Abstract:
Diabetic retinopathy (DR), a major cause of blindness worldwide, poses a substantial and escalating burden on public health. The limitations of current therapeutic modalities highlight the pressing need for continued innovation in therapeutic interventions. This review comprehensively delineated the knowledge architecture, research focal points, and emerging directions in DR therapeutics. Targeted biological agents have recently emerged as principal research directions in DR therapy and hold substantial promise. They are expected to achieve the goals of blocking disease progression more persistently, effectively, and less invasively than nonbiological therapeutics through multitarget synergy and long-acting sustained-release formulations. In clinical practice, the paradigm of DR therapy has shifted toward personalized and precision medicine, with optimized subthreshold micropulse laser as a promising adjunctive therapy for enhancing long-term treatment outcomes. Looking ahead, therapeutic monitoring in DR may evolve beyond conventional morphological grading to incorporate multimodal precision diagnostics, artificial intelligence-driven broad-spectrum screening, and biomarker-based early warning systems. This review concludes with a discussion on prospects and challenges in DR therapeutics, with special emphasis on emerging drug candidates, recent clinical trial findings, and novel insights that may inform the next generation of therapeutic interventions for DR.
